NPFL: Amuneke reveals target for Heartland

Heartland Technical Adviser, Emmanuel Amuneke, has reiterated his plans for the team in the Nigeria Premier Football League, NPFL, this season.

Amuneke stated that his target is to stabilize the club.

The Naze Millionaires have registered eight wins, nine draws, and nine defeats in the NPFL this season.

Heartland currently occupies 13th position on the NPFL table with 33 points from 26 games.

The Naze Millionaires were held to a goalless draw by El-Kanemi Warriors in a Matchday 26 fixture at the Dan Anyiam Stadium on Wednesday.

“My expectations and target are to play and win our games and stabilize the club,” Amuneke told Sports Village Square.

Heartland will lock horns with Ikorodu City in their next league game on Sunday.
